文档章节

Redis+MongDB 常用命令

满小茂
 满小茂
发布于 2015/12/24 15:54
字数 510
阅读 159
收藏 10

MySQL

  远程连接mysql:  

  
  mysql -u root -h 127.0.0.1 -P 3306 -p xxxxx

     远程获取mysql数据库表脚本:  

 
 mysqldump -u用户名 -p密码 -h主机 数据库.表 > 导出sqld的路径

 

Redis

   远程连接:

 redis-cli -h 127.0.0.1 -p 6379

   选择数据库:

select 0

密码认证:

auth password

 清空当前数据库: 

 FLUSHDB

     清空所有数据库:

FLUSHALL

      ping PONG返回响应是否连接成功

      echo 在命令行打印一些内容

      select 0~15 编号的数据库

      quit  /exit 退出客户端

      dbsize 返回当前数据库中所有key的数量

      info 返回redis的相关信息

      config get dir/* 实时传储收到的请求

      flushdb 删除当前选择数据库中的所有key

      flushall 删除所有数据库中的数据库

 

MongDB

     远程连接: 指定端口 指定数据库

  mongo 172.26.32.9:27107/man -u root  -p

      show dbs:显示数据库列表 

      show collections:显示当前数据库中的集合(类似关系数据库中的表) 

      show users:显示用户

     use <db name>切换当前数据库,如果没有这个数据库则创建这个数据库

      db.foo.find():对于当前数据库中的foo集合进行数据查找(由于没有条件,会列出所有数据) 
      db.foo.find( { a : 1 } ):对于当前数据库中的foo集合进行查找,条件是数据中有一个属性叫a,且a的值为1

     db.foo.insert({"id":12345}):对于当前数据库中的foo集合插入数据

      删除当前使用数据库

      db.dropDatabase();  从指定主机上克隆数据库

     db.cloneDatabase(“127.0.0.1”); 将指定机器上的数据库的数据克隆到当前数据库

 

服务启动

mysql服务启动

1、使用 service 启动:service mysqld start

停止:service mysqld stop

2、使用 mysqld 脚本启动:/etc/inint.d/mysqld start

停止:/etc/inint.d/mysqld stop

monodb启动服务

mongod -f  mongod.conf       #使用配置文件启动

mongod -dbpath='/data/mongo/data'   #使用指定数据存放路径

redis启动服务

./redis-server &

 

 

 

 

 

 

 

 

 

 

© 著作权归作者所有

共有 人打赏支持
满小茂
粉丝 74
博文 119
码字总数 131884
作品 0
成都
程序员
私信 提问
一步一步学会puppet(五)--配置文件和常用命令详解

这篇博文主要解析了puppet的配置文件和常用命令,以备以后查阅; =================================================================== 1 配置文件 1.1 组织结构 2 常用命令 2.1 常用命令 ...

xxrenzhe11
2014/05/18
0
0
Redis笔记整理(一):Redis安装配置与数据类型操作

[TOC] Redis简介 Redis的特点 Redis的优势 Redis应用 Redis安装配置 Redis安装 windows下直接解压即可使用,主要说明Linux下的安装方式 : Redis配置 Redis配置查看 Redis的配置文件位于Red...

xpleaf
06/26
0
0
Linux 命令中 which、whereis、locate 命令的用法。

which 命令 which 命令的作用是,在 PATH 变量指定的路径中搜索可执行文件的所在位置。它一般用来确认系统中是否安装了指定的软件。 (1)命令格式 which 可执行文件名称 (2)常用范例 例一...

hgditren
2017/10/30
0
0
puppet的认识

puppet的配置文件和常用命令 1 配置文件 1.1 组织结构 配置文件位于/etc/puppet目录下,主要有如下几类文件: puppet.conf:主配置文件,分段定义的; [main]:默认配置段 [agent]:agent端配...

Songoo
2014/05/24
0
0
苦背Linux命令行,不如实例操作!

"唯有实践才可以提升能力" "每天学习一小点,进步一大点" ——来自课程评论 许多新手学习Linux命令行会直接拿着各种大全背,但这种做法见效会比较慢,过几天不去看也容易忘。 如果能边看文档...

实验楼
08/02
0
0

没有更多内容

加载失败,请刷新页面

加载更多

Mariadb二进制包安装,Apache安装

安装mariadb 下载二进制包并解压 [root@test-a src]# wget https://downloads.mariadb.com/MariaDB/mariadb-10.2.6/bintar-linux-glibc_214-x86_64/mariadb-10.2.6-linux-glibc_214-x86_64.t......

野雪球
今天
3
0
ConcurrentHashMap 高并发性的实现机制

ConcurrentHashMap 的结构分析 为了更好的理解 ConcurrentHashMap 高并发的具体实现,让我们先探索它的结构模型。 ConcurrentHashMap 类中包含两个静态内部类 HashEntry 和 Segment。HashEnt...

TonyStarkSir
今天
3
0
大数据教程(7.4)HDFS的java客户端API(流处理方式)

博主上一篇博客分享了namenode和datanode的工作原理,本章节将继前面的HDFS的java客户端简单API后深度讲述HDFS流处理API。 场景:博主前面的文章介绍过HDFS上存的大文件会成不同的块存储在不...

em_aaron
昨天
4
0
聊聊storm的window trigger

序 本文主要研究一下storm的window trigger WindowTridentProcessor.prepare storm-core-1.2.2-sources.jar!/org/apache/storm/trident/windowing/WindowTridentProcessor.java public v......

go4it
昨天
7
0
CentOS 生产环境配置

初始配置 对于一般配置来说,不需要安装 epel-release 仓库,本文主要在于希望跟随 RHEL 的配置流程,紧跟红帽公司对于服务器的配置说明。 # yum update 安装 centos-release-scl # yum ins...

clin003
昨天
11
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部